What are the main private school options available for families in Clinton, Oklahoma, and what are their core educational approaches?

In Clinton, Oklahoma, families have a few primary private school choices, each with a distinct mission. **Southwest Christian School** offers a non-denominational Christian education from Pre-K through 12th grade, focusing on college-prep academics integrated with biblical principles. **St. Mary's Catholic School**, part of the St. Mary's Catholic Church parish, provides a faith-based education for Pre-K through 8th grade, emphasizing Catholic values and tradition. While not in Clinton proper, **Elk City Christian School** (about 25 miles west) is a common consideration for some Clinton-area families seeking a K-12 Christian environment. The availability is limited compared to larger cities, so understanding each school's religious affiliation and grade range is a key first step.

How does tuition at private schools in Clinton, OK, compare to state averages, and what financial aid options are typically available?

Tuition for private schools in Clinton is generally below the national average, reflecting Oklahoma's lower cost of living. For the 2024-2025 academic year, expect ranges from approximately $4,000 to $7,000 annually for elementary grades, with higher rates for secondary levels. Specific rates should be confirmed directly with each school. Financial aid is often need-based and may include parish subsidies for St. Mary's (for active members), sibling discounts, and limited scholarship funds. It's important to note that Oklahoma does **not** have a state-funded voucher or tax-credit scholarship program, so families cannot rely on state assistance and must explore each school's internal aid programs and payment plans.

What is the typical enrollment timeline and process for private schools in Clinton, and are there waitlists?

The enrollment process for Clinton's private schools usually begins in January or February for the following fall, with priority often given to re-enrolling students and siblings. **Southwest Christian School** and **St. Mary's Catholic School** typically require an application, academic records, a family interview, and possibly a student assessment. Due to their limited capacity, popular grades (especially Kindergarten and early elementary) can fill quickly, leading to waitlists. It is highly advisable to contact the schools by early winter to express interest and attend any open houses. Unlike large urban private schools, the process in Clinton is more personal but still requires proactive planning.

For families considering both sectors, what are the practical considerations when comparing private and public schools in Clinton, Oklahoma?

The decision in Clinton often centers on educational philosophy, class size, and cost. **Clinton Public Schools** offer a no-tuition option with a wider range of elective courses, larger-scale athletic programs, and specialized services (like extensive special education resources). The private schools offer a specific faith-based environment, consistent disciplinary standards, and often a tighter-knit community feel. A practical consideration is transportation, as private schools do not provide district busing. Additionally, while Clinton public schools are well-regarded, some families choose private options for continuity of religious education or a perceived more structured environment. Visiting both a public school and the private campuses is crucial to feel the difference firsthand.
